Prayer Service & Site Blessing at King's Adelaide Hills
11 Apr 2022

It was indeed a great blessing to be among pastors, enrolled families and the wider Adelaide Hills community on Saturday.

From the opportunity to pray over the buildings with pastors from local church communities, to placing scripture and the hopes of parents for their children on the walls of the classroom, to celebrating the establishing of a King’s community with the wider hills community on the lawns of the Newnham offices, the day was a wonderful testament to the provision and the promise of God for the Adelaide Hills community.

King’s Baptist Grammar School was established in 1983 with 38 founding students. In 2023, some 40 years later, we commence a new learning journey in partnership with the Adelaide Hills community. Saturday was an exciting and heartfelt beginning to this journey.
